RSM 970 S MSSR Mode-S sensor

The RSM 970 S sensor is an advanced Monopulse Mode S interrogator. Developed as part of the Mode S system and built around validated elements that have proven their performance through extensive programmes of operational and technical tests, the RSM 970 S can be fitted as an MSSR or Mode S sensor. The Mode S functions cover the selective interrogation, the enhanced surveillance, and full data link.
